Home loan settlement costs generally are normally taken for dos% so you’re able to 6% of your own amount borrowed.
They may be able vary commonly by financial and place.
You can find an easy way to lower your closing costs and then make the loan less costly.
Closing costs are one of the several biggest initial expenditures possible have to cover when buying a home. And while the amount you’ll be able to spend can differ some a good part, you could potentially generally expect to pay somewhere between dos% and six% of your total amount borrowed.
Who would amount to doing $6,600 so you’re able to $20,000 on an average-priced house (according to Redfin studies throughout the next one-fourth off 2024). That is together with a 20% down payment from $82,460

Closing costs consist of the new fees your happen when you look at the techniques of getting a home loan. They can can consist of their financial lender’s origination fees, the assessment you’ve got with the house, or the cost of delivering a subject search. Settlement costs are incredibly entitled since you’ll be able to spend these costs from the the fresh closing of financing. (mehr …)
